유니콘 오버로드: 초보자가 할만한 게임 코딩의 세계
게임 코딩의 세계는 신비로운 유니콘처럼 매력적이에요. 코드 한 줄 한 줄이 플레이어의 경험을 만들어 주고, 창의력과 논리적인 사고를 발전시켜주는 곳이죠. 특히, “유니콘 오버로드”와 같은 게임은 초보자들이 쉽게 접근할 수 있는 훌륭한 기회를 제공합니다. 이제 이 매력적인 세계에 대해 깊이 탐구해보도록 해요!
유니콘 오버로드란 무엇인가?
게임 개요
“유니콘 오버로드”는 색감 넘치고 재미있는 스토리라인을 가진 게임이에요. 플레이어는 유니콘 캐릭터를 조정하면서 다양한 미션을 수행하고, 게임 내에서 적과 싸우거나 퍼즐을 해결해야 해요. 이 게임은 어린이부터 성인까지 모두 즐길 수 있도록 설계되어 있어요.
게임의 특징
- 다양한 캐릭터: 각기 다른 능력을 가진 유니콘들이 존재해요.
- 창의적인 레벨 디자인: 각 레벨마다 독특한 테마와 도전 과제가 있어요.
- 코딩 학습 요소: 간단한 명령어와 로직을 사용해 유니콘을 조작할 수 있어요.
게임 코딩의 기본 원리
게임 코딩은 컴퓨터 과학의 한 분야로, 게임의 전반적인 구조와 기능을 이해하는 것이 중요해요. 초보자들이 접근하기 쉬운 몇 가지 주요 개념을 알아볼까요?
주요 개념
- 변수: 게임에서 다양한 상태를 저장하는데 사용해요. 예를 들어, 유니콘의 체력이나 점수를 저장할 수 있어요.
- 조건문: 특정 조건이 충족되었을 때 실행되는 코드 블록이에요. 적이 가까이 오면 유니콘이 공격하는 식으로 사용할 수 있죠.
- 반복문: 특정 행동을 반복해야 할 때 사용해요. 예를 들어, 유니콘이 연속으로 점프할 때 유용해요.
코드 예제
아래는 유니콘이 점프하는 간단한 코드 예제예요:
jump()
이 코드는 유니콘이 점프하기 위해 에너지를 확인하는 과정이에요. 에너지가 있으면 점프를 하고, 없다면 에너지가 부족하다는 메시지를 출력해요.
유니콘 오버로드에서의 코딩 학습
게임을 플레이하면서 코딩을 배우는 것은 매우 효과적이에요. 유니콘 오버로드는 플레이어가 자연스럽게 코드의 기본 개념을 익힐 수 있도록 도와줘요.
실습 활동
- 단계별 튜토리얼: 각 레벨에서 제공되는 튜토리얼을 따라 하다 보면, 자연스럽게 코딩 기술을 익힐 수 있어요.
- 커뮤니티와 함께하는 학습: 유니콘 오버로드의 다양한 포럼과 커뮤니티에서 다른 플레이어들과 경험을 나누고, 문제를 해결해가는 과정에서 많은 것을 배울 수 있어요.
게임 안의 교육 요소
유니콘 오버로드는 그 자체로 교육적인 경험이 될 수 있죠. 즐겁게 게임을 하면서 동시에 프로그래밍의 기초를 배우는 것은 매우 좋은 방법이에요.
주요 기능 | 설명 |
---|---|
간단한 코드 사용 | 쉬운 템플릿 제공으로 초보자도 쉽게 이해 가능 |
스토리 기반 학습 | 스토리를 따라가며 실습할 수 있어 집중력이 높아짐 |
다양성 | 여러 레벨과 캐릭터로 지루함 없이 계속 도전 가능 |
추가적인 학습 자료
게임을 통해 기초를 익힌 후에는 심화 학습이 필요해요. 아래 자료들을 활용해 보세요:
- 온라인 코스: Udemy, Codecademy 등에서 코딩 강좌 수강
- 도서: “게임 프로그래밍 패턴”과 같은 참고서적
- 영상 강좌: YouTube에서 다양한 프로그래밍 관련 채널
유니콘과 함께하는 코딩의 미래
유니콘 오버로드는 단순한 게임 그 이상이에요. 이 게임은 초보자들이 코딩을 즐겁고 쉽게 배울 수 있는 경로를 열어주죠. 코딩은 이제 더 이상 검은 터미널 속에서의 복잡한 소명어가 아니라, 이 마음속의 유니콘을 타고 나갈 수 있는 믿음직한 동반자예요!
결론
게임 코딩은 정말 매력적이고 흥미로운 도전이에요. “유니콘 오버로드”와 같은 게임을 통해 초보자들도 쉽고 재미있게 코딩을 배울 수 있는 환경을 제공받아요. 지금 바로 시작해서 자신만의 유니콘을 조작해 보세요! 이 기회를 놓치지 마세요.
지금 행동하세요! 새로운 코딩의 세계에 발을 내딛어 보세요.
가장 중요한 문장은 착안해주세요:
코딩은 이제 더 이상 검은 터미널 속에서의 복잡한 소명어가 아니라, 이 마음속의 유니콘을 타고 나갈 수 있는 믿음직한 동반자예요!